Verdict
Coquelicot found plenty for pressure when making all at Sandown at the start of the month. But third and fourth, WHITEHOTCHILLFILI and Terresita re-oppose on better terms, and Harry Fry’s mare may come out on top today over this longer trip. Glimpse Of Gala is entitled to reverse Ascot running with Coquelicot on much better terms and Get A Tonic looks a danger as she probably ran her best race to date when runner-up in a Grade 3 at Haydock last time. I Spy A Diva is upped in class seeking a four-timer but still preferred to an out-of-sorts Midnightreflection.
